A cryogenic pump is a type of vacuum pump that uses a cryogenic surface to absorb and condense gases to transform high vacuum into ultra-high vacuum. It can function at temperatures as low as -1200 C and produces a cleaner, oil-free vacuum while operating at faster pumping speeds. Cryogenic pumps are used extensively in semiconductor production and testing because of their improved thermal and electrical conductivity, lower operating power consumption, and increased electronic reliability. The market is driven by rising demand for LNG, power generation, energy for homes and businesses, healthcare, and the production of renewable energy. The growing need for cryogenic gases from the energy and power sectors especially the oil and gas industry as well as liquid gases from different end-user sectors is the main factor propelling the cryogenic pump market. Increased gas-based power efficiency, government initiatives, and the growing use of LNG, which offers an inexpensive, clean energy source, are driving growth in the global cryogenic pump market. For instance, the National Mission on Transformative Mobility and Battery Storage of India seeks to advance clean energy technologies, such as cryogenic pumps for the transportation and storage of hydrogen. However, increased pricing competition and a preference for small-scale manufacturers as a result of rising raw material costs in cryogenic pumps have caused market volatility brought on by metal prices.

The centrifugal pump segment is predicted to hold the greatest market share through the forecast period.

Based on the type, the cryogenic pump market is classified into positive displacement pumps and centrifugal pumps. Among these, the centrifugal pump segment is predicted to hold the largest market share through the forecast period. Centrifugal pumps use only two-phase gas-liquid fluid for priming, converting engine rotational energy into fluid-moving energy. Steel, food and beverage, metal and mining, and oil and gas are among the industries that are using them more and more.

The nitrogen segment is anticipated to hold the greatest market share during the projected timeframe. 

Based on the cryogen type, the cryogenic pump market is divided into nitrogen, oxygen, argon, liquefied natural gas, and others. Among these, the nitrogen segment is anticipated to hold the fastest market share during the projected timeframe. Nitrogen is an essential cryogenic gas utilized in a variety of industries, including food and beverage and polymers. It is a well-liked option in the sector since it can also be used as a high-pressure gas for laser-cutting metal and steel.

The oil & gas segment is anticipated to hold the greatest market share during the projected timeframe.   

Based on the end-user, the cryogenic pump market is divided into oil & gas, metallurgy, power generation, chemical & petrochemical, marine, and others. Among these, the oil & gas segment is anticipated to hold the largest market share during the projected timeframe. The market share of the oil and gas segment, which includes cryogenic liquefied natural gas pumps, is the largest because of their extensive use in gas-to-liquid operations.

Asia Pacific is estimated to hold the largest share of the cryogenic pump market over the forecast period.

Asia Pacific is estimated to hold the largest share of the cryogenic pump market over the forecast period. The expansion of the energy and metallurgy industries in China and India, as well as the growing emphasis on renewable energy sources and the increased demand for chemicals and metallurgy, are driving the cryogenic pump market in the Asia Pacific region. One major element influencing this growth is urbanization.

North America is predicted to have the fastest CAGR growth in the cryogenic pump market over the forecast period. Growing industrial infrastructure and increased investment in the oil and gas industry are the main drivers of the demand for LNG exports in the US and Canada. LNG-based power plants are necessary due to the depletion of coal resources. The largest market share for cryogenic pumps is found in the United States.
